6. The grantee (at postgraduate level) must act as a teaching assistant (TA) or research
assistant (RA) in a way specified by the thesis advisor/assigned advisor.
7. It is compulsory that the grantee (at undergraduate level) contributes to as many
Faculty/University activities as possible as directed by the Foreign Student Office (FSO).
8. Throughout the study program, the grantee (at undergraduate level) must get a Grade
Point Average (GPA) of not less than 2.00 in the first semester; 2.25 Cumulative Grade
Point Average in the second semester; 2.50 Cumulative Grade Point Average in the
fourth semester and henceforth. The grantee (at postgraduate level) must maintain a
Cumulative Grade Point Average at the end of each academic year of 3.25. For researchbased students, the academic advisor will submit an evaluation at the end of each
semester. Failing to meet with this requirement will result in a termination of the
scholarship.
9. The grantee must pay attention to his/her study by following the guidance of (name of
advisor) ... The grantee is required to complete the course of
study without any willful abandonment of the scholarship. Early termination of this
agreement can be made by written notice from the grantee with approval of (name of
advisor) ...
10. If the grantee receives another scholarship, research fund, or other kind of funding, the
granter reserves the right to adjust the scholarship in accordance with the terms and
conditions of this scholarship agreement.
11. Every international student is required to attend a 30 hour Thai course prior to the
commencement of the first semester. For an undergraduate student who chooses to
study in a program taught in Thai, he/she must take 5 Thai courses in the first year and
acquire at least a C in each course before being approved to study the selected degree
program in the subsequent year.
12. If the grantee is unable to follow the conditions specified in this agreement, the granter
reserves the right to terminate the scholarship in accordance with the terms and
conditions of this scholarship agreement.
13. The grantee must be a full-time student based strictly on a study plan and maintain
his/her student status.
14. The grantee understands that the scholarship coverage, which includes: 1) a round trip
international airfare ticket (economy class); for those physically in Thailand, he/she
receives only a return ticket, 2) tuition fee waiver throughout the length of the study, 3)
international student fee waiver throughout the length of the study, 4) on-campus
accommodation (excluding incurred electricity cost), 5) health insurance, 6) 6,000.-Bht
monthly allowance, 7)Thai Non-ED visa application and its renewal throughout the length
of the study, 8) 4,000.-Bht for study material per academic year, and 9) a one-time
thesis/dissertation proposal fee and a one-time thesis/dissertation defense fee, is nonnegotiable.

15. The grantee understands that the monthly allowance is dispersed based strictly on the
length of the program and will cease after the completion of the program of study.
